Output e24ca46b6afbf862460164af5c57d59c6bfaea8ff447d336069a0252d0a1f859:8

value
2375837252
script pubkey
OP_0 OP_PUSHBYTES_32 d916bf839b8081daa35848b803a40c159be4862d26ca889ec5c54bd72ef7b212
address
bc1qmyttlqumszqa4g6cfzuq8fqvzkd7fp3dym9g38k9c49awthhkgfqz5j9qa
transaction
e24ca46b6afbf862460164af5c57d59c6bfaea8ff447d336069a0252d0a1f859
spent
true